import sys
##### Glue Code #####
def log(*args):
r"""
x.log(str) -> None -- log the given argument as information in the LogPython category
"""
pass
def log_warning(*args):
r"""
x.log_warning(str) -> None -- log the given argument as a warning in the LogPython category
"""
pass
def log_error(*args):
r"""
x.log_error(str) -> None -- log the given argument as an error in the LogPython category
"""
pass
def log_flush(*args):
r"""
x.log_flush() -> None -- flush the log to disk
"""
pass
def reload(*args):
r"""
x.reload(str) -> None -- reload the given Unreal Python module
"""
pass
def load_module(*args):
r"""
x.load_module(str) -> None -- load the given Unreal module and generate any Python code for its reflected types
"""
pass
def find_object(*args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.find_object(outer, name, type=Object) -> Object -- find an already loaded Unreal object with the given outer and name, optionally validating its type
"""
pass
def load_object(*args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.load_object(outer, name, type=Object) -> Object -- load an Unreal object with the given outer and name, optionally validating its type
"""
pass
def load_class(*args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.load_class(outer, name, type=Object) -> Class -- load an Unreal class with the given outer and name, optionally validating its base type
"""
pass
def find_asset(*args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.find_asset(name, type=Object) -> Object -- find an already loaded Unreal asset with the given name, optionally validating its type
"""
pass
def load_asset(*args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.load_asset(name, type=Object) -> Object -- load an Unreal asset with the given name, optionally validating its type
"""
pass
def find_package(*args):
r"""
x.find_package(name) -> Package -- find an already loaded Unreal package with the given name
"""
pass
def load_package(*args):
r"""
x.load_package(name) -> Package -- load an Unreal package with the given name
"""
pass
def get_default_object(*args):
r"""
x.get_default_object(type) -> Object -- get the Unreal class default object (CDO) of the given type
"""
pass
def purge_object_references(*args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.purge_object_references(obj, include_inners=True) -> None -- purge all references to the given Unreal object from any living Python objects
"""
pass
def generate_class(*args):
r"""
x.generate_class(type) -> None -- generate an Unreal class for the given Python type
"""
pass
def generate_struct(*args):
r"""
x.generate_struct(type) -> None -- generate an Unreal struct for the given Python type
"""
pass
def generate_enum(*args):
r"""
x.generate_enum(type) -> None -- generate an Unreal enum for the given Python type
"""
pass
def get_type_from_class(*args):
r"""
x.get_type_from_class(class) -> type -- get the best matching Python type for the given Unreal class
"""
pass
def get_type_from_struct(*args):
r"""
x.get_type_from_struct(struct) -> type -- get the best matching Python type for the given Unreal struct
"""
pass
def get_type_from_enum(*args):
r"""
x.get_type_from_enum(enum) -> type -- get the best matching Python type for the given Unreal enum
"""
pass
def NSLOCTEXT(*args):
r"""
x.NSLOCTEXT(ns, key, source) -> Text -- create a localized Text from the given namespace, key, and source string
"""
pass
def LOCTABLE(*args):
r"""
x.LOCTABLE(id, key) -> Text -- get a localized Text from the given string table id and key
"""
pass
class ScopedSlowTask(object):
r"""
Type used to create and managed a scoped slow task in Python
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
def __enter__(self, *args):
r"""
x.__enter__() -> self -- begin this slow task
"""
pass
def __exit__(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.__exit__(type, value, traceback) -> None -- end this slow task
"""
pass
def make_dialog_delayed(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.make_dialog_delayed(delay, can_cancel=False, allow_in_pie=False) -> None -- creates a new dialog for this slow task after the given time threshold. If the task completes before this time, no dialog will be shown
"""
pass
def make_dialog(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.make_dialog(can_cancel=False, allow_in_pie=False) -> None -- creates a new dialog for this slow task, if there is currently not one open
"""
pass
def enter_progress_frame(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.enter_progress_frame(work=1.0, desc=Text()) -> None -- indicate that we are to enter a frame that will take up the specified amount of work (completes any previous frames)
"""
pass
def should_cancel(self, *args):
r"""
x.should_cancel() -> bool -- True if the user has requested that the slow task be canceled
"""
pass
class ObjectIterator(object):
r"""
Type for iterating Unreal Object inst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
class ClassIterator(object):
r"""
Type for iterating Unreal class types
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
class StructIterator(object):
r"""
Type for iterating Unreal struct types
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
class TypeIterator(object):
r"""
Type for iterating Python types
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
class ValueDef(object):
r"""
Type used to define constant values from Python
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
class PropertyDef(object):
r"""
Type used to define UProperty fields from Python
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
class FunctionDef(object):
r"""
Type used to define UFunction fields from Python
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
class _WrapperBase(object):
r"""
Base type for all UE4 exposed types
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
class _ObjectBase(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ed object instances
"""
def __init__(self, outer=None, name="None"):
pass
def _post_init(self, *args):
r"""
x._post_init() -> None -- called during Unreal object initialization (equivalent to PostInitProperties in C++)
"""
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args):
r"""
X.cast(object) -> Object -- cast the given object to this Unreal object type
"""
pass
@classmethod
def get_default_object(cls, *args):
r"""
X.get_default_object() -> Object -- get the Unreal class default object (CDO) of this type
"""
pass
@classmethod
def static_class(cls, *args):
r"""
X.static_class() -> Class -- get the Unreal class of this type
"""
pass
def get_class(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_class() -> Class -- get the Unreal class of this instance
"""
pass
def get_outer(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_outer() -> Object -- get the outer object from this instance (if any)
"""
pass
def get_typed_outer(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_typed_outer(type) -> type() -- get the first outer object of the given type from this instance (if any)
"""
pass
def get_outermost(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_outermost() -> Package -- get the outermost object (the package) from this instance
"""
pass
def get_name(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_name() -> str -- get the name of this instance
"""
pass
def get_fname(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_fname() -> FName -- get the name of this instance
"""
pass
def get_full_name(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_full_name() -> str -- get the full name (class name + full path) of this instance
"""
pass
def get_path_name(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_path_name() -> str -- get the path name of this instance
"""
pass
def get_world(self, *args):
r"""
x.get_world() -> World -- get the world associated with this instance (if any)
"""
pass
def modify(self, *args):
r"""
x.modify(bool) -> bool -- inform that this instance is about to be modified (tracks changes for undo/redo if transactional)
"""
pass
def rename(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.rename(name=None, outer=None) -> bool -- rename this instance
"""
pass
def get_editor_property(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.get_editor_property(name) -> object -- get the value of any property visible to the editor
"""
pass
def set_editor_property(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.set_editor_property(name, value) -> None -- set the value of any property visible to the editor, ensuring that the pre/post change notifications are called
"""
pass
class StructBase(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ed struct inst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
def _post_init(self, *args):
r"""
x._post_init() -> None -- called during Unreal struct initialization (equivalent to PostInitProperties in C++)
"""
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args):
r"""
X.cast(object) -> struct -- cast the given object to this Unreal struct type
"""
pass
@classmethod
def static_struct(cls, *args):
r"""
X.static_struct() -> Struct -- get the Unreal struct of this type
"""
pass
def __copy__(self, *args):
r"""
x.__copy__() -> struct -- copy this Unreal struct
"""
pass
def copy(self, *args):
r"""
x.copy() -> struct -- copy this Unreal struct
"""
pass
def assign(self, *args):
r"""
x.assign(object) -> None -- assign the value of this Unreal struct to value of the given object
"""
pass
def to_tuple(self, *args):
r"""
x.to_tuple() -> tuple -- break this Unreal struct into a tuple of its properties
"""
pass
def get_editor_property(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.get_editor_property(name) -> object -- get the value of any property visible to the editor
"""
pass
def set_editor_property(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.set_editor_property(name, value) -> None -- set the value of any property visible to the editor, ensuring that the pre/post change notifications are called
"""
pass
class EnumBase(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ed enum instances
"""
def __init__(self):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args):
r"""
X.cast(object) -> enum -- cast the given object to this Unreal enum type
"""
pass
@classmethod
def static_enum(cls, *args):
r"""
X.static_enum() -> Enum -- get the Unreal enum of this type
"""
pass
class _EnumEntry(object):
def __init__(self, enum, name, value):
self.enum = enum
self.name = name
self.value = value
def __get__(self, obj, type=None):
return self
def __repr__(self):
return "{0}.{1}".format(self.enum, self.name)
@property
def __name__(self):
return None
@__name__.setter
def __name__(self, value):
pass
@property
def __doc__(self):
return None
@__doc__.setter
def __doc__(self, value):
pass
class DelegateBase(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ed delegate inst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args):
r"""
X.cast(object) -> struct -- cast the given object to this Unreal delegate type
"""
pass
def __copy__(self, *args):
r"""
x.__copy__() -> delegate -- copy this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def copy(self, *args):
r"""
x.copy() -> struct -- copy this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def is_bound(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_bound() -> bool -- is this Unreal delegate bound to something?
"""
pass
def bind_delegate(self, *args):
r"""
x.bind_delegate(delegate) -> None -- bind this Unreal delegate to the same object and function as another delegate
"""
pass
def bind_function(self, *args):
r"""
x.bind_function(obj, name) -> None -- bind this Unreal delegate to a named Unreal function on the given object instance
"""
pass
def bind_callable(self, *args):
r"""
x.bind_callable(callable) -> None -- bind this Unreal delegate to a Python callable
"""
pass
def unbind(self, *args):
r"""
x.unbind() -> None -- unbind this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def execute(self, *args):
r"""
x.execute(...) -> value -- call this Unreal delegate, but error if it's unbound
"""
pass
def execute_if_bound(self, *args):
r"""
x.execute_if_bound(...) -> value -- call this Unreal delegate, but only if it's bound to something
"""
pass
class MulticastDelegateBase(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ed multicast delegate inst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args):
r"""
X.cast(object) -> struct -- cast the given object to this Unreal delegate type
"""
pass
def __copy__(self, *args):
r"""
x.__copy__() -> struct -- copy this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def copy(self, *args):
r"""
x.copy() -> struct -- copy this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def is_bound(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_bound() -> bool -- is this Unreal delegate bound to something?
"""
pass
def add_function(self, *args):
r"""
x.add_function(obj, name) -> None -- add a binding to a named Unreal function on the given object instance to the invocation list of this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def add_callable(self, *args):
r"""
x.add_callable(callable) -> None -- add a binding to a Python callable to the invocation list of this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def add_function_unique(self, *args):
r"""
x.add_function_unique(obj, name) -> None -- add a unique binding to a named Unreal function on the given object instance to the invocation list of this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def add_callable_unique(self, *args):
r"""
x.add_callable_unique(callable) -> None -- add a unique binding to a Python callable to the invocation list of this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def remove_function(self, *args):
r"""
x.remove_function(obj, name) -> None -- remove a binding to a named Unreal function on the given object instance from the invocation list of this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def remove_callable(self, *args):
r"""
x.remove_callable(callable) -> None -- remove a binding to a Python callable from the invocation list of this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def remove_object(self, *args):
r"""
x.remove_object(obj) -> None -- remove all bindings for the given object instance from the invocation list of this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def contains_function(self, *args):
r"""
x.contains_function(obj, name) -> bool -- does the invocation list of this Unreal delegate contain a binding to a named Unreal function on the given object instance
"""
pass
def contains_callable(self, *args):
r"""
x.contains_callable(callable) -> bool -- does the invocation list of this Unreal delegate contain a binding to a Python callable
"""
pass
def clear(self, *args):
r"""
x.clear() -> None -- clear the invocation list of this Unreal delegate
"""
pass
def broadcast(self, *args):
r"""
x.broadcast(...) -> None -- invoke this Unreal multicast delegate
"""
pass
class Name(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ed name inst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args):
r"""
X.cast(object) -> Name -- cast the given object to this Unreal name type
"""
pass
def is_valid(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_valid() -> bool -- is this Unreal name valid?
"""
pass
def is_none(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_none() -> bool -- is this Unreal name set to NAME_None?
"""
pass
class Text(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ed text inst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args):
r"""
X.cast(object) -> Text -- cast the given object to this Unreal text type
"""
pass
@classmethod
def as_number(cls, *args):
r"""
X.as_number(num) -> Text -- convert the given number to a culture correct Unreal text representation
"""
pass
@classmethod
def as_percent(cls, *args):
r"""
X.as_percent(num) -> Text -- convert the given number to a culture correct Unreal text percentgage representation
"""
pass
@classmethod
def as_currency(cls, *args):
r"""
X.as_currency(val, code) -> Text -- convert the given number (specified in the smallest unit for the given currency) to a culture correct Unreal text currency representation
"""
pass
def is_empty(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_empty() -> bool -- is this Unreal text empty?
"""
pass
def is_empty_or_whitespace(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_empty_or_whitespace() -> bool -- is this Unreal text empty or only whitespace?
"""
pass
def is_transient(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_transient() -> bool -- is this Unreal text transient?
"""
pass
def is_culture_invariant(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_culture_invariant() -> bool -- is this Unreal text culture invariant?
"""
pass
def is_from_string_table(self, *args):
r"""
x.is_from_string_table() -> bool -- is this Unreal text referencing a string table entry?
"""
pass
def to_lower(self, *args):
r"""
x.to_lower() -> Text -- convert this Unreal text to lowercase in a culture correct way
"""
pass
def to_upper(self, *args):
r"""
x.to_upper() -> Text -- convert this Unreal text to uppercase in a culture correct way
"""
pass
def format(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.format(...) -> Text -- use this Unreal text as a format pattern and generate a new text using the format arguments (may be a mapping, sequence, or set of (optionally named) arguments)
"""
pass
class Array(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ed array inst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
X.cast(type, obj) -> Array -- cast the given object to this Unreal array type
"""
pass
def __copy__(self, *args):
r"""
x.__copy__() -> Array -- copy this Unreal array
"""
pass
def copy(self, *args):
r"""
x.copy() -> Array -- copy this Unreal array
"""
pass
def append(self, *args):
r"""
x.append(value) -> None -- append the given value to the end of this Unreal array (equivalent to TArray::Add in C++)
"""
pass
def count(self, *args):
r"""
x.count(value) -> integer -- return the number of times that value appears in this this Unreal array
"""
pass
def extend(self, *args):
r"""
x.extend(iterable) -> None -- extend this Unreal array by appending elements from the given iterable (equivalent to TArray::Append in C++)
"""
pass
def index(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.index(value, start=0, stop=len) -> integer -- get the index of the first matching value in this Unreal array, or raise ValueError if missing (equivalent to TArray::IndexOfByKey in C++)
"""
pass
def insert(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.insert(index, value) -> None -- insert the given value at the given index in this Unreal array
"""
pass
def pop(self, *args):
r"""
x.pop(index=len-1) -> value -- remove and return the value at the given index in this Unreal array, or raise IndexError if the index is out-of-bounds
"""
pass
def remove(self, *args):
r"""
x.remove(value) -> None -- remove the first matching value in this Unreal array, or raise ValueError if missing
"""
pass
def reverse(self, *args):
r"""
x.reverse() -> None -- reverse this Unreal array in-place
"""
pass
def sort(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.sort(cmp=None, key=None, reverse=False) -> None -- stable sort this Unreal array in-place
"""
pass
def resize(self, *args):
r"""
x.resize(len) -> None -- resize this Unreal array to hold the given number of elements
"""
pass
class FixedArray(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ed fixed-array inst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
X.cast(type, obj) -> FixedArray -- cast the given object to this Unreal fixed-array type
"""
pass
def __copy__(self, *args):
r"""
x.__copy__() -> FixedArray -- copy this Unreal fixed-array
"""
pass
def copy(self, *args):
r"""
x.copy() -> FixedArray -- copy this Unreal fixed-array
"""
pass
class Set(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ed set inst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
X.cast(type, obj) -> Set -- cast the given object to this Unreal set type
"""
pass
def __copy__(self, *args):
r"""
x.__copy__() -> Set -- copy this Unreal set
"""
pass
def copy(self, *args):
r"""
x.copy() -> Set -- copy this Unreal set
"""
pass
def add(self, *args):
r"""
x.add(value) -> None -- add the given value to this Unreal set if not already present
"""
pass
def discard(self, *args):
r"""
x.discard(value) -> None -- remove the given value from this Unreal set, or do nothing if not present
"""
pass
def remove(self, *args):
r"""
x.remove(value) -> None -- remove the given value from this Unreal set, or raise KeyError if not present
"""
pass
def pop(self, *args):
r"""
x.pop() -> value -- remove and return an arbitrary value from this Unreal set, or raise KeyError if the set is empty
"""
pass
def clear(self, *args):
r"""
x.clear() -> None -- remove all values from this Unreal set
"""
pass
def difference(self, *args):
r"""
x.difference(...) -> Set -- return the difference between this Unreal set and the other iterables passed for comparison (ie, all values that are in this set but not the others)
"""
pass
def difference_update(self, *args):
r"""
x.difference_update(...) -> None -- make this set the difference between this Unreal set and the other iterables passed for comparison (ie, all values that are in this set but not the others)
"""
pass
def intersection(self, *args):
r"""
x.intersection(...) -> Set -- return the intersection between this Unreal set and the other iterables passed for comparison (ie, values that are common to all of the sets)
"""
pass
def intersection_update(self, *args):
r"""
x.intersection_update(...) -> None -- make this set the intersection between this Unreal set and the other iterables passed for comparison (ie, values that are common to all of the sets)
"""
pass
def symmetric_difference(self, *args):
r"""
x.symmetric_difference(other) -> Set -- return the symmetric difference between this Unreal set and another (ie, values that are in exactly one of the sets)
"""
pass
def symmetric_difference_update(self, *args):
r"""
x.symmetric_difference_update(other) -> None -- make this set the symmetric difference between this Unreal set and another (ie, values that are in exactly one of the sets)
"""
pass
def union(self, *args):
r"""
x.union(...) -> Set -- return the union between this Unreal set and the other iterables passed for comparison (ie, values that are in any set)
"""
pass
def update(self, *args):
r"""
x.update(...) -> None -- make this set the union between this Unreal set and the other iterables passed for comparison (ie, values that are in any set)
"""
pass
def isdisjoint(self, *args):
r"""
x.isdisjoint(other) -> bool -- return True if there is a null intersection between this Unreal set and another
"""
pass
def issubset(self, *args):
r"""
x.issubset(other) -> bool -- return True if another set contains this Unreal set
"""
pass
def issuperset(self, *args):
r"""
x.issuperset(other) -> bool -- return True if this Unreal set contains another
"""
pass
class Map(_WrapperBase):
r"""
Type for all UE4 exposed map instances
"""
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
pass
@classmethod
def cast(cls,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
X.cast(key, value, obj) -> Map -- cast the given object to this Unreal map type
"""
pass
def __copy__(self, *args):
r"""
x.__copy__() -> Map -- copy this Unreal map
"""
pass
def copy(self, *args):
r"""
x.copy() -> Map -- copy this Unreal map
"""
pass
def clear(self, *args):
r"""
x.clear() -> None -- remove all items from this Unreal map
"""
pass
@classmethod
def fromkeys(cls,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
X.fromkeys(sequence, value=None) -> Map -- returns a new Unreal map of keys from the sequence using the given value (types are inferred)
"""
pass
def get(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.get(key, default=None) -> value -- x[key] if key in x, otherwise default
"""
pass
def setdefault(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.setdefault(key, default=None) -> value -- set key to default if key not in x and return the new value of key
"""
pass
def pop(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.pop(key, default=None) -> value -- remove key and return its value, or default if key not present, or raise KeyError if no default
"""
pass
def popitem(self, *args):
r"""
x.popitem() -> pair -- remove and return an arbitrary pair from this Unreal map, or raise KeyError if the map is empty
"""
pass
def update(self, *args, **kwargs):
r"""
x.update(...) -> None -- update this Unreal map from the given mapping or sequence pairs type or key->value arguments
"""
pass
def has_key(self, *args):
r"""
x.has_key(k) -> bool -- does this Unreal map contain the given key? (equivalent to k in x)
"""
pass
def iteritems(self, *args):
r"""
x.iteritems() -> iter -- an iterator over the key->value pairs of this Unreal map
"""
pass
def iterkeys(self, *args):
r"""
x.iterkeys() -> iter -- an iterator over the keys of this Unreal map
"""
pass
def itervalues(self, *args):
r"""
x.itervalues() -> iter -- an iterator over the values of this Unreal map
"""
pass
def items(self, *args):
r"""
x.items() -> iter -- a Python list containing the key->value pairs of this Unreal map
"""
pass
def keys(self, *args):
r"""
x.keys() -> iter -- a Python list containing the keys of this Unreal map
"""
pass
def values(self, *args):
r"""
x.values() -> iter -- a Python list containing the values of this Unreal map
"""
pass
def viewitems(self, *args):
r"""
x.viewitems() -> view -- a set-like view of the key->value pairs of this Unreal map
"""
pass
def viewkeys(self, *args):
r"""
x.viewkeys() -> view -- a set-like view of the keys of this Unreal map
"""
pass
def viewvalues(self, *args):
r"""
x.viewvalues() -> view -- a view of the values of this Unreal map
"""
pass
